Keep the pressure off the toes, don't think of weight but more of pressure. The pressure should be on the ball of the foot. Your weight is balanced over the hand and two feet from a 3 point stance and the hands and feet from a 4 point stance. Play close attention to how I establish the ball of my foot by dorsi-flexing the toes first and then putting pressure on the ball of my foot to raise my heel off the ground.
